Join the Corporate Law and Financial Regulation Research Program of Melbourne Centre for Commercial Law (University of Melbourne) for a seminar featuring Professor Douglas Arner of the University of Hong Kong on the Geopolitics of Cross-Border Money and Payments: Technology, Law and Regulation.
As finance, technology, and regulation become renewed battlegrounds for global power, Professor Arner will explore how 21st-century innovations—such as CBDCs, fast payment systems, tokenised deposits, and stablecoins—are reshaping cross-border payments and challenging the dominance of traditional currency systems.
